The sons of Levi were Gershon, Kohath, and Merari.
2
The sons of Kohath were Amram, Izhar, Hebron, and Uzziel.
3
The children of Amram were Aaron, Moses, and Miriam. The sons of Aaron were Nadab, Abihu, Eleazar, and Ithamar.
4
Eleazar became the father of Phinehas; Phinehas became the father of Abishua;
5
Abishua became the father of Bukki; Bukki became the father of Uzzi;
6
Uzzi became the father of Zerahiah; Zerahiah became the father of Meraioth;
7
Meraioth became the father of Amariah; Amariah became the father of Ahitub;
8
Ahitub became the father of Zadok; Zadok became the father of Ahimaaz;
9
Ahimaaz became the father of Azariah; Azariah became the father of Johanan;
10
Johanan became the father of Azariah; it was he who held the office of priest in the house that Solomon built in Jerusalem.
11
Azariah became the father of Amariah; Amariah became the father of Ahitub;
12
Ahitub became the father of Zadok; Zadok became the father of Shallum;
13
Shallum became the father of Hilkiah; Hilkiah became the father of Azariah;
14
Azariah became the father of Seraiah; Seraiah became the father of Jehozadak;
15
Jehozadak also was taken away when the LORD allowed Judah and Jerusalem to be carried into exile by Nebuchadnezzar.

🎶👑🕊️ Summary of 1 Chronicles 6 – The Genealogy of the Tribe of Levi: Priests, Worship, and Service in the House of the LORD
1 Chronicles 6 especially records the complete genealogy of the tribe of Levi, the tribe appointed by God to serve in the House of the LORD. This chapter sets out the line of the high priests, the roles of the singers and musicians in worship, and the cities of the Levites. Unlike the other tribes, the tribe of Levi did not receive a large territory, but was given special cities because their task was to serve the LORD fully.
This chapter emphasizes the importance of worship, service, and faithfulness to God, especially in the context of restoration after the exile.
📌 1. The Genealogy of the High Priests from Aaron to Jehozadak (verses 1–15)
➡️ It begins with Levi → Kohath → Amram → Aaron and continues to Zadok and Jehozadak
➡️ Jehozadak was the high priest when the people were taken to Babylon
➡️ This line is important because it became the legal basis for service in the House of the LORD
🎯 Holy service requires a lineage and a calling established by the LORD.
📌 2. Other Branches of the Tribe of Levi: Kohath, Gershon, Merari (verses 16–30)
➡️ The tribe of Levi consisted of three main branches: Kohath, Gershon, and Merari
➡️ Each had a role in the service of the Tabernacle and the House of the LORD
➡️ The long genealogy shows the importance of service across generations
🎯 Service to God is a holy inheritance that must be passed on.
📌 3. The Duties of Musicians and Singers in Worship (verses 31–48)
➡️ Those who were appointed to sing and play musical instruments were recorded
➡️ Names such as Heman, Asaph, and Ethan are mentioned — important figures in the Psalms
➡️ They came from the descendants of Kohath, Gershom, and Merari
🎯 Worship is at the center of Israel’s spiritual life and is served by those appointed by God.
📌 4. The Priests and the Cities of the Levites (verses 49–81)
➡️ Aaron and his descendants served in the most holy place, offered sacrifices, and led the people
➡️ The tribe of Levi was given 48 cities in various tribes of Israel (including cities of refuge such as Hebron)
➡️ Those cities were spread out so they could serve the people throughout the whole land
🎯 The service of God must be present throughout the land, not only at the center of worship.
